Xometry Unveils Its Next-Gen Workcenter Experience

Xometry launched its next-gen Workcenter for manufacturing partners, featuring AI-driven job matching, improved performance tracking, and faster payment access. The redesign includes a new homepage and Job Board, reducing job review time by 60% and increasing acceptance rates by 15% in early tests, according to the company.

Xometry (XMTR) Q2 2026 Earnings Call Transcript

Xometry (XMTR) reported Q2 2026 revenue of $229.3 million, up 41% year over year, with marketplace revenue of $215.4 million (+45%). Adjusted EBITDA was $14.1 million, and non-GAAP net income was $9.9 million. The company raised Q3 2026 revenue guidance to $234 million to $236 million and full-year 2026 revenue growth to 33% to 34%.

Xometry, Inc. Q2 2026 Earnings Call Summary

Xometry, Inc. reported Q2 2026 results and said revenue growth accelerated for a fourth straight quarter, driven by a product-led shift toward an AI ecosystem. It cited improved CNC cost prediction accuracy (+~15%), record 175 net new enterprise accounts over $50,000, and reduced ad spend to 3.4% of revenue. Full-year 2026 revenue growth guidance raised to 33%-34% and marketplace gross margin target 35%-40%. Cash was $517M after a $248M follow-on and $50M Siemens investment.

Xometry, Inc.: Xometry Reports Record Second Quarter 2026 Results

Xometry (NASDAQ: XMTR) reported Q2 2026 results: revenue rose 41% to $229 million, with marketplace revenue up 45% to $215 million. Gross profit increased 34% to $87.2 million and Adjusted EBITDA rose $10.2 million to $14.1 million. Cash and equivalents were $517 million after a June equity offering. Q3 guidance calls for $234-$236 million revenue and $16-$17 million Adjusted EBITDA.
